Kellesha Clarke Brice
About Kellesha Clarke Brice
Kellesha Clarke Brice is a Senior Manager in Trading Documentation, Legal at CIBC, with extensive experience in legal roles within the banking and financial services industry.
Current Role at CIBC
Kellesha Clarke Brice holds the position of Senior Manager, Trading Documentation, Legal at CIBC. She has been serving in this role since 2017, based in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. Previous Positions at CIBC
Before her current role, Kellesha Clarke Brice was the Senior Manager of the Contract Support Group within CIBC Corporate Services from 2014 to 2017. Educational Background in Law
Kellesha Clarke Brice has a robust educational background in law. She holds a Bachelor of Law as well as a Bachelor of Science from The University of the West Indies Cave Hill Campus, where she studied from 2000 to 2006. She furthered her education with a focus on education and law from 2006 to 2008 at the same institution. Additionally, she studied at York University - Osgoode Hall Law School in 2016, earning a Certificate in Negotiating and Drafting IT Agreements.
